Sample ID | 282-3-26 |
---|---|
Species | rotundifolia |
Genus | Goodenia |
Family | GOODENIACEAE |
Search |
Pollen / Spore | pollen |
---|---|
Morphologic type | tricolporate |
Surface pattern | reticulate |
Equatorial size | min 24.5, mean 27, max 29 |
Polar size | min 24, mean 26, max 27.5 |
Equatorial shape | circular |
Grain arrangement | dicot |
Pore surface shape | lalongate |
Wall thickness | 1.8 |
Dispersal form | monad |
Morphology notes | Tricolporate. Prolate spheroidal to oblate spheroidal in ev, triangular with blunt apices in pv. Pore lalongate, with patterned membranes. 27 (24-29) x 26 (24-28). Sexine lt nexine; tegillate; thickens at poles. |
